What is Ceclor?
Ceclor has active ingredients of cefaclor. It is often used in sinusitis. eHealthMe is studying from 1,673 Ceclor users. Check the latest studies of Ceclor.
What is Ceftin?
Ceftin has active ingredients of cefuroxime axetil. It is often used in sinusitis. eHealthMe is studying from 4,333 Ceftin users. Check the latest studies of Ceftin.

Drug effectiveness:
Ceclor:
- not at all: 4.76 %
- somewhat: 14.29 %
- moderate: 33.33 %
- high: 28.57 %
- very high: 19.05 %
Ceftin:
- not at all: 5.46 %
- somewhat: 31.15 %
- moderate: 31.69 %
- high: 25.68 %
- very high: 6.01 %
